CVE:CVE-2024-25616 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-08 06:31:23.561770 |
Details available
LOW (3.7)
Aruba has identified certain configurations of ArubaOS that can lead to partial disclosure of sensitive information in the IKE_AUTH negotiation process. The scenarios in which disclosure of potentially sensitive information can occur are complex, and depend on factors beyond the control of attackers.

CVE:CVE-2024-25615 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-08 06:31:23.561294 |
Details available
MEDIUM (5.3)
An unauthenticated Denial-of-Service (DoS) vulnerability exists in the Spectrum service accessed via the PAPI protocol in ArubaOS 8.x. Successful exploitation of this vulnerability results in the ability to interrupt the normal operation of the affected service.

CVE:CVE-2024-25614 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-08 06:31:23.559767 |
Details available
MEDIUM (5.5)
There is an arbitrary file deletion vulnerability in the CLI used by ArubaOS. Successful exploitation of this vulnerability results in the ability to delete arbitrary files on the underlying operating system, which could lead to denial-of-service conditions and impact the integrity of the controller.

CVE:CVE-2024-25613 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-08 06:31:23.559256 |
Details available
HIGH (7.2)
Authenticated command injection vulnerabilities exist in the ArubaOS command line interface. Successful exploitation of these vulnerabilities result in the ability to execute arbitrary commands as a privileged user on the underlying operating system.
